Straight Bets (Win, Place, Show):
These bets are based on the position of a horse or the range of positions where the horse will finish.
Exacta/Trifecta Bets:
You can select the order a race will finish in the exact order (Exacta) or the top three (Trifecta).
Boxed Bets:
In boxed bets, choose the top finishers in no particular order, improving your chances of winning.
Accumulator Bets (Parlays):
Combine multiple individual bets into one super bet with multipliers, leading to improved odds and winnings.
Quinella Bets:
With quinella bets, select any two horses to finish in the first and second place, in any order.
Live Bet on Horse Races:
Place bets while the race is on, having a better chance of accurately predicting the outcome.

Cheltenham Festival:
The Cheltenham Festival is a four-day event that features some of the best horse racing in the world. With a large international following, several American betting sites for UK punters offer betting on this illustrious event.
Tingle Creek:
The Tingle Creek race is one of the younger horse racing events, first run in 1969. Renamed after one of the most prestigious horses, the event draws the attention of the world, including non-GamStop bookies.
Investec Derby:
One of the most popular horse racing events in the world, the ‘Epsom Derby’ gained the tag from its sponsorship with Investec. This elite race is one of the most prominent of the flat racing season, with thousands of bets placed yearly.
Royal Ascot:
Royal Ascot hosts some of the most prominent races in the UK, even attracting members of the royal family. Horse racing sites not affected by GamStop host this prestigious event, and it is open to UK players.
Kentucky Derby:
The Kentucky Derby is the American equivalent of the Epsom Derby and offers grade I stakes racing. As the premier event in the country, betting on the Derby is available on American betting sites for UK punters.
Melbourne Cup:
The Melbourne Cup is Australia’s most prestigious horse racing event and has existed since 1861. Known locally as “the race that stops a nation”. The Melbourne Cup draws the attention of fans of horse racing betting not on GamStop in the UK and other countries.
St Leger Festival:
One of the oldest horse racing events in the world, the St Leger Festival has been run since 1776. The race features three-year-old fillies and thoroughbred colts and draws the attention of non-GamStop bookmakers.
Prix de l’Arc de Triomphe:
The Prix de l’Arc de Triomphe is one of the most prestigious horse racing events in the world and attracts the most lucrative purse.
Grand National:
The Grand National race is a part of the Grand National festival, with over £150 million bet on the race across its three-day run.
